cubital covert, one of the covertefethers or tectgices lo- cated en the cubit, forearm, or antebrachium of a bird; an antebrachial covert; a secondary covert.
greater covert, one of a set or subdivision of the sec- ondary upper wing^coverts constituting a single row which projects furthest upon the secondary remiges or flight^ ethers ; one of the major tect^ices of the wing; a greater upper secondary covert; a greater secondary covert.
inferior covert, a lower covert; an under covert.
least covert, a lesser covert.
lesser covert, one of a set or subdivision of the secondary upper wmg^coverts, including all those clast as either greater coverts or median coverts; one of the minor tectices of the wing; a lesser secondary covert.
lower covert, one of the covert^fethers or tectgices en the lower or under side of a bird's wing; one of the inferior tectjices of the wing; an under covert: an inferior covert.
manual covert, one of the covert^fethers or tectr.ices located en a bird's manus or hand; a primary covert.
median covert, one of a set or subdivision of the second- ary upper wmg^coverts constituting a single row located midway between the greater coverts and the lesser coverts; one of the median tectrjces of the wing; a median secon- dary covert; a middle secondary covert; a middle covert.
middle covert, a middle secondary covert; a median covert.
primary covert, one of the wing^coverts which overlie the bases of the primary remiges or flightefethers ; a manual covert.
secondary covert, one of the wmg^coverts which overlie the bases of the secondary remiges or flightef ethers ; an antebrachial or cubital covert.
superior covert, an upper covert.
under covert, one of the covert^fethers or tectpces located en the under or lower side of a bird's wing; one of the in- ferior tectjices of the wing; a lower covert; an inferior covert.
upper covert, one of the covert^fethers or tectpces located en the upper side of a bird's wing; one of the superior tectrjces of the wing; a superior covert.
